If you’re looking to enhance the visual appeal of a space economically, consider checking out local thrift shops and vintage boutiques. These places often offer a variety of unique, budget-friendly options to create inviting atmospheres. I have found that visiting during sales or special discount days can yield even greater savings, making it easier to mix and match pieces.

Online marketplaces, such as Facebook Marketplace and Craigslist, are excellent resources for sourcing affordable decor. Here, you can discover gently used items that might need just a little sprucing up. Make sure to set alerts for specific types of pieces you’re searching for to be the first to snag the best deals.

If you prefer a more streamlined shopping experience, check out retailers like IKEA and Wayfair, which frequently have sales, especially during holiday weekends. They offer contemporary styles at lower price points, allowing for a cohesive look without breaking the bank. Joining their mailing lists can also provide access to exclusive discounts.

For those who enjoy the thrill of a treasure hunt, consider attending estate sales or garage sales in your neighborhood. Often, you can find high-quality items at a fraction of their original cost. It’s also a great way to discover one-of-a-kind pieces that can truly elevate the style of any room.

Online Marketplaces for Budget-Friendly Staging Furniture

A great way to find affordable options for home presentation is through various online platforms. Here are some top choices that I recommend:

1. Facebook Marketplace

This is an excellent platform for both new and used items. You can find local sellers offering a wide range of household accessories. Utilize search filters to narrow down results by price, location, and category.

2. Craigslist

A classic choice for local deals, Craigslist often has listings for home decor and essential items at low prices. Check the “for sale” section, particularly in the furniture category. Be cautious and arrange safe meetups for transactions.

3. OfferUp

Focuses on local buying and selling, making it easy to connect with sellers nearby. Look for ratings and reviews to gauge seller reliability. I’ve discovered many gems in the home section here.

4. Letgo (now part of OfferUp)

Before merging with OfferUp, Letgo was well-known for its user-friendly interface. This platform continues to offer quality goods at reasonable prices. Browse categories that suit home staging needs for great finds.

5. eBay

An excellent option for both bidding and buying at fixed prices. Check regularly; you might discover unique items that stand out. Utilize filters to find items within your budget, and explore auctions for potentially lower prices.

6. Amazon Warehouse Deals

If you’re looking for brand-new items at reduced rates, explore Amazon’s warehouse deals section. These are open-box or slightly damaged products offered at significant discounts, perfect for home setups.

7. Wayfair Outlet

This is the clearance section of Wayfair, featuring a range of goods at discounted rates. Regularly check for deals on home accessories that fit various styles and themes.

8. Overstock

A premier destination for affordable home goods. Overstock often has promotional discounts. Consider signing up for newsletters to receive notifications on special deals.

9. Thrift Stores & Antiques Online

  • Etsy: Great for unique handmade or vintage items.
  • Chairish: Specializes in vintage and used items, perfect for distinctive decorations.

Leverage these platforms for budget-conscious finds that will beautifully enhance any space. Always check seller reviews and product conditions to ensure satisfaction with your purchases.

Local Thrift Stores and Their Hidden Gems

My best finds for unique decor and practical pieces often come from local second-hand shops. These spots are treasure troves for anyone looking to furnish spaces on a budget. I recommend visiting regularly, as inventory changes frequently, and what you might expect to find today can be completely different next week.

Pay attention to items that may need a little sprucing up. A coat of paint or new upholstery can transform a tired sofa into a statement piece. Look for solid wood pieces; they are usually durable and can be refinished or painted for a fresh look. Don’t overlook smaller items like lamps or artwork. They can add character and warmth to any room.

Get to know the staff at your favorite store. They can provide tips on when restocks happen and might even alert you to items that fit your needs. Some stores also have special sales days where everything is discounted further, so keep an eye out for those opportunities.

Another tip is to check out clearance sections, where heavily reduced items are often found. These can be great opportunities to snag quality items at even lower prices. I’ve discovered kitchenware, decorative pillows, and small tables that turned out to be perfect for staging.

Renting vs. Buying: Cost-Effective Options for Staging

I recommend considering both options based on the frequency and scale of your projects. Rentals can be more practical for one-time events or short-term engagements, while purchasing can be beneficial for those with ongoing needs.

Cost Comparison

Here’s a breakdown of costs to help you determine the best approach:

Aspect Renting Buying
Initial Investment Lower upfront costs Higher upfront costs
Long-term Cost Can accumulate over time Amortized over multiple uses
Flexibility Variety available, can swap styles Less variety, limited to what is owned
Maintenance No maintenance costs Ongoing maintenance required
Storage No storage needed Requires space for storage

Best Fit for Your Needs

For sporadic staging tasks, rentals suit better due to minimal commitment. For frequent projects, purchasing makes sense to eventually lower costs. Consider your specific situation with cost, space, and project frequency to make the right call.

Functional Repurposing

Consider repurposing items you already own. A vintage trunk can serve as a unique coffee table, while old windows might become charming wall art or room dividers. Utilizing items in innovative ways not only saves money but also adds individuality to a space.

Paint and Upholstery Transformations

Simple painting techniques can revitalize tired items. A fresh coat of white or a bold color transforms the look entirely. For upholstered items, adding new fabric or reupholstering can give a dated piece a modern twist. Fabrics can be sourced from clearance sections or remnants at local stores, helping to keep costs low.

Connect with local DIY communities online or in person to exchange ideas, swap materials, or even collaborate on projects. Embracing creativity and resourcefulness empowers you to craft affordable solutions tailored to your vision.

Local Furniture Auctions for Bargain Staging Items

Attending local auctions has proven to be a fantastic source for cost-efficient décor pieces. These events often feature a wide variety of items, from vintage chairs to contemporary tables, all available at competitive pricing.

One key advantage of auctions is the opportunity to bid on unique items that might not be found in traditional retail outlets. It’s essential to research upcoming auctions in your area and familiarize yourself with the auction houses. Websites and community boards often provide schedules and previews, allowing you to identify pieces of interest.

When participating in an auction, set a firm budget before you start bidding. This strategy prevents overspending during the excitement of the auction. Additionally, pay attention to the condition of each item, as minor repairs can significantly decrease the final bid. Look for pieces that can be refreshed with a paint job, new upholstery, or simple hardware updates.

Be prepared for a dynamic environment; auctions can be fast-paced. Arriving early allows you to inspect items closely and gauge their potential value. Joining mailing lists of local auction houses can keep you informed about special events and themed auctions that might suit your staging needs.

Overall, local auctions present a remarkable chance to acquire distinctive and affordable décor elements, making them a smart choice for enhancing any space.
